What Is Bird Flu And What Causes It?

Also known as avian influenza, Bird Flu is a type of viral infection that has its effect not only on the birds, but also on humans and several other animals as well, but most forms of this virus are restricted to birds, that’s why the name Bird Flu. H5N1 is the most common type, and it can affect humans and other animals if they come in contact with the carrier. It came into existence in 1997 and is said to have killed nearly 60% of those who were affected by it.

Many experts and researchers believe that it has the capability to become a possible pandemic threat for humans as well as other animals.

H5N1 was the first type that infected humans, otherwise, bird flu has several types. It started in 1997 in Hong Kong and was mainly due to the poor handling of infected poultry. It could come in contact with human beings through infected bird feces, nasal secretions, or even the secretions from the mouth or eyes. However, properly cooked poultry, even if it’s infected, won’t infect us and it’s safe.

What Are The Symptoms Of Bird Flu? – Bird Flu Symptoms

There are high chances that you have H5N1 if you’re experiencing the typical flu-like symptoms which are as follows:

1. Cough

2. Diarrhea

3. Difficulty in Breathing

4. High fever

5. Headache

6. Muscle aches

7. Malaise

8. Runny Nose

9. Sore throat

Risk Factors Related to Avian Influenza

The risk to have H5N1 stays for quite some time once it appears anywhere, and is easily transferred via the carriers, as mentioned earlier. Your risk to come across H5N1 is higher if you are:

1. A poultry farmer

2. If you visit the areas which have been affected by it

3. Exposed to the birds who’ve been infected

4. If you eat undercooked eggs or poultry products

5. A household member or a healthcare worker who has been infected.

How Is Avian Influenza Diagnosed?

To test Bird Flu, there is one test approved by the Centers for Disease Control and Prevention proven to show good results and it is called influenza A/H5 virus real-time RT-PCR primer and probe test. Before this, few of the following tests could be done for a better understanding of your problem:

1. Auscultation (to test abnormal breath sounds)

2. White blood cell differential

3. Nasopharyngeal culture

4. X-Ray of the Chest

What Is Bird Flu Treatment?

The bird flu(avian influenza) treatment depends on the type of bird flu, as there is a variety of them. But, the most common one is the treatment with antiviral medication, however, it is necessary to take it in 48 hours as the symptoms appear. With the medication, in most of the cases, things get fine, but a proper diagnosis by an expert would be the best option in a severe case.

How To Prevent Bird Flu?

If you’ve come across some of the bird flu symptoms, then doctors might give you a shot so that you don’t get the human strain of the virus. You should:

1. Avoid open-air markets especially to poultries

2. Avoid contact with possibly infected birds

3. Avoid eating undercooked eggs or poultry products

Maintain hygiene and wash hands regularly, which is a must during this already prevailing coronavirus pandemic. FDA has already approved a vaccine for use, but it isn’t used now because experts say that it should be used once it starts spreading amongst people.
